What impact would new nuclear power stations in Switzerland have on hydropower – a renewable energy source that forms the backbone of the national electricity supply – and on its economic viability? Studies and scenarios have recently brought this issue more firmly into the spotlight of the national energy policy debate.
This was reason enough for Alpiq to carry out its own analyses, which paint a more nuanced and balanced picture.
Our simulations were carried out using fundamental models that explicitly account for both European interconnectivity – Switzerland is at the centre of the European grid – and the technical limitations of hydropower and nuclear energy.
These analyses were carried out by two independent Alpiq teams and cover various nuclear scenarios – including that of a study by the University of Applied Sciences of Valais (+1,600 / +3,200 MW) and more realistic scenarios for Switzerland (long-term operation of Gösgen* and Leibstadt beyond 60 years, +2,280 MW, as well as a new 1,200 MW plant by 2050). The results also take meteorological variability into account and relate to the year 2050.
